A nourishing, dog-safe crockpot bone broth packed with collagen, amino acids, and minerals to support your pupโ€™s joints, digestion, and immune system. This slow-cooked broth is simple, budget-friendly, and a tail-wagging favorite for dogs of all ages.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 lbs raw bones (chicken feet, beef knuckles, or turkey necks)

  • 12โ€“16 cups filtered water

  • 2 carrots, sliced

  • 2 celery stalks, chopped

  • 1 tablespoon parsley (optional, for digestion)

  • 1โ€“2 tablespoons apple cider vinegar (to extract nutrients)

Instructions

  1. Place bones and safe vegetables into the crockpot.

  2. Add filtered water until ingredients are fully covered.

  3. Stir in apple cider vinegar to help release minerals.

  4. Set crockpot on low and cook for 18โ€“24 hours.

  5. Strain broth with a fine mesh sieve to remove bones and veggies.

  6. Allow broth to cool completely before serving.

  7. Refrigerate for 4โ€“5 days or freeze in small portions for up to 3 months.
